Maison  >  Article  >  interface Web  >  Comment lire le contenu d'un fichier texte en HTML

Comment lire le contenu d'un fichier texte en HTML

下次还敢
下次还敢original
2024-04-05 10:33:171315parcourir

HTML ne peut pas lire les fichiers texte, mais cela peut être réalisé en utilisant JavaScript : utilisez fetch() pour obtenir le contenu du fichier ; utilisez la méthode Response.text() pour obtenir le texte ; traitez la réponse lue dans la méthode then().

Comment lire le contenu d'un fichier texte en HTML

Comment lire le contenu d'un fichier texte en utilisant HTML

HTML lui-même ne peut pas lire directement le contenu d'un fichier texte. Cependant, cette fonctionnalité peut être facilement implémentée à l'aide de JavaScript.

Méthode :

Pour lire le contenu d'un fichier texte, vous pouvez utiliser la fonction JavaScript suivante :

<code class="javascript">fetch('textfile.txt')
  .then(response => response.text())
  .then(data => {
    // 对读取到的文本文件内容进行处理
  });</code>

Description :

  • fetch() La fonction permet de récupérer les ressources du serveur (fichier texte). La méthode fetch() 函数用于从服务器获取资源(文本文件)。
  • response.text() 方法返回文本文件的文本内容。
  • then() 方法用于处理成功读取文本文件后的响应。

示例:

下面是一个读取文本文件内容并将其显示在网页上的 HTML 代码示例:

<code class="html"><html>
<head>
  <script>
    fetch('textfile.txt')
      .then(response => response.text())
      .then(data => {
        document.getElementById('content').innerHTML = data;
      });
  </script>
</head>
<body>
  <div id="content"></div>
</body>
</html></code>

在这个示例中:

  • textfile.txt 是要读取的文本文件。
  • content
  • response.text() renvoie le contenu texte du fichier texte. La méthode
🎜then() est utilisée pour gérer la réponse après avoir lu avec succès le fichier texte. 🎜🎜🎜🎜Exemple : 🎜🎜🎜Voici un exemple de code HTML qui lit le contenu d'un fichier texte et l'affiche sur une page Web : 🎜rrreee🎜Dans cet exemple : 🎜🎜🎜textfile.txt code> est le fichier texte à lire. 🎜🎜<code>content est un élément HTML qui contiendra le contenu du fichier texte lu. 🎜🎜

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Déclaration:
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n